dc.description.abstractGmelina arborea Roxb.,is a rainforest tree that is found in tropical region. The study investigates the feasibility and effect on the properties of concrete by using sawdust ash as pozzolan produced from Gmelina arborea Roxb.,tree in Abia state. Concrete mix of 1:2:4 by volume batching and constant water to cement ratio of 0.6 were used. The slumps were 60, 70, 89, 60, 55 and 47mm at partial replacement of 0, 5, 10, 15, 20 and 25% respectively. The compressive strength at 28th day of curing for 0, 5, 10, 15, 20 and 25% were 27.67, 27.22, 21.22, 20.00, 18.89 and 18.33 N/mm2 respectively. The research on the slump indicates that all the replacements have good workability to be categorized as true slump, with the 10% partial replacement having the highest workability. In addition, the compressive strengths developed at 28th day showed that the concretes developed good strength, which can increase with further age of curing because pozzolanic concrete develops late better strength and durability than ordinary concrete.sr
dc.description.abstractGmelina arborea Roxb., je stablo kišne prašume koje se nalazi u tropskom regionu Nigerije. Studija istražuje izvodljivost i uticaj na osobine betona korišćenjem pepela od piljevine stabla Gmelina arborea Roxb., u državi Abia, Nigerija. Korišćena je betonska mešavina 1:2:4 zapreminskog odnosa i konstantni odnos vode prema cementu od 0,6. Testovi su od 60, 70, 89, 60, 55 i 47 mm uz delimičnu nadoknadu od 0, 5, 10, 15, 20 i 25% dodatka (sadržaj pepela). Vrednosti uzoraka na pritisak posle 28-og dana od očvršćivanja za dodatke od 0, 5, 10, 15, 20 i 25% bila je 27.67, 27.22, 21.22, 20.00, 18.89 i 18.33 N/mm2 retrospektivno. Istraživanje % zamene (dodatka) pokazuje da sve ispitivane vrednosti zamene imaju dobre osobine i mogu se kategorisati kao dobro poboljšanje mešavine, pri čemu 10% delimična zamena (dodatak pepela) daje najbolje osobine betona. Pored toga, čvrstoća betona na pritisak dobijena posle 28. dana pokazuje da beton razvija dobru čvrstoću, koja se može povećavati u narednim godinama, jer pozolanski beton razvija kasnije bolju pritisnu čvrstoću (tvrdoću) i izdržljivost od običnog (standardni) betona.sr
